#b8678f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b8678f is composed of 72.2% red, 40.4%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 22.3%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 330.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 56.3%. #b8678f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#71001f.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#b8678f color description : Slightly desaturated pink.

#b8678f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b8678f has RGB values of R:184, G:103,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.22,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12085135.

Shades and Tints of #b8678f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080406 is the darkest color, while #fdf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8678f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96898f is the less saturated color, while #fd228e is the most saturated one.
